Nxserver

OpenSUSEa suomeksi

Sisällysluettelo

Mikä on Nxserver?

Nomachine Nxserver Free Edition on täysin ilmainen terminaalipalvelin graafisen etäyhteyden muodostamiseen. Yhteys on täysin turvallinen, koska liikenne on salattu SSH/SSL v3 -yhteydellä. Lisäksi salaukseen käytetään julkisen avaimen salausta ja 128 bittistä vaihtuvia satunnaisesti generoituja evästeitä. Nxserver tukee myös äänien tunnelointia KDE ja GNOME käyttöliittymistä. Voit vaikka kuunnella mp3 musiikkia etäkoneelta. Voit jakaa kansioita pöytäkoneeltasi ja käyttää niitä nxserverilä. Nxserver tarjoaa myös paljon muuta joten jos olet kiinnostunut niin käy tutustumassa heidän www-sivuihin.

Asennus

Asennus rpm-paketeista

Lataa seuraavat paketit haluamaasi hakemistoon. Avaa konsoli ja mene hakemistoon, jonne haluat paketit tallentaa.

  • nxclient
  • nxserver
  • nxnode
http://www.nomachine.com/select-package.php?os=linux&id=1


Kun olet ladannut kaikki paketit, niin kirjaudu root-käyttäjäksi ja mene hakemistoon jonne paketit tallensit.
esim:

cd /home/matti/downloads/NX
zypper in *.rpm

Tarkista vielä, että sinulla on ssh-portti(22) avattuna palomuurista.

NX Client for Windows
http://www.nomachine.com/download-client-windows.php

NX Client for Linux
http://www.nomachine.com/download-client-linux.php

Asennuksen testaus

Testaus Linuxissa

Voit tarkistaa asennuksen joko samalta koneelta johon nxserverin asensit tai sitten asentaa client-sovellus johonkin toiseen koneeseen.
Linux:ssa client ohjelma löytyy
K-menu -> Internet -> NX Client for Linux -> NX Client for Linux
Määritä avautuneeseen ikkunaan yhteydelle nimi ja anna nxserverin ip-osoite.
NX connection wizard
Valitse seuraavasta ikkunasta käyttämäsi työpöytä, resoluutio, ja aktivoi SSL-salaus.
NX connection wizard
Lopuksi voit valita jos haluat tarkemmat asetukset auki ennen yhteyden tallentamista.
Mikäli haluat säätää asetuksia tarkemmin laita rasti kohtaan "Show the advanced configuration dialog" ja paina Finish
NX connection wizard
Sitten vaan annat Linux käyttäjätunnuksesi ja salasanasi ja nautit nopeasta ja toimivasta etäyhteydestä.
Kun haluat lopettaa etäyhteyden voit painaa ruksia ikkunan oikeassa yläreunassa tai painaa ctrl+alt+t
Saat vaihtoehdoiksi:
Suspend = kyseinen yhteys jää taustalle auki ja voit milloin tahansa palata siihen. Tämä on käytännöllinen esimerkiksi silloin kun aloitat vaikka jonkin suuren tiedoston lataamisen, mutta sinun täytyy sammuttaa client-yhteys vaikka bootataksesi koneesi. Tämä ei siis katkaise latausta tai muita käynnistämiäsi ohjelmia.
Terminate = Yhteys lopetetaan ja kaikki avatut ohjelmat ja lataukset suljetaan.
Cancel = Peruu sulkemisen ja palaa normaaliin tilaan.

Hakemiston jakaminen

Windows koneelta

Voit jakaa hakemistoja Windows client koneeltasi ja käyttää niitä nxserveri koneelta.

Muokkaa root käyttäjänä seuraavaa tiedostoa /usr/NX/etc/node.cfg

MOUNT_SHARE_PROTOCOL = "both"
SHARE_BASE_PATH = "/hakemisto jonne haluat liitokset tehdä"
ENABLE_FILE_SHARING = "1"

Jaa haluamasi hakemistosto Windows:ssa ihan normaalisti. Avaa sitten Start -> Programs -> NX Client for Windows -> NX Client for Windows ja valitse avautuneesta ikkunasta Configure...
NX Client for Windows

Seuraavaksi mene Services välilehdelle. Valitse Add
NX Client for Windows

Sinulla pitäisi näkyä pudotusvalikossa (Resource) kaikki jaossa olevat hakemistot. Valitse haluamasi kansio ja kohtaan Mount on: määrittelet hakemiston jonne se nxserverilla liitetään. Username/Password kenttiin sinun tulee määrittää Client koneen käyttäjätunnuksesi, mahdollinen domain jos sellainen on käytössä ja salasanasi. Lopuksi paina Ok Seuraavan kerran kun avaat yhteyden liitetään jaettu kansio automaattisesti ja siitä tulee myös pop-up ilmoitus näytölle.
NX Client for Windows

Vianmääritys

  • Mikäli kirjautuminen ei onnistu asennuksen jälkeen ja saat seuraavan virheilmoituksen "NX> 204 Authentication failed.". Tarkista "/etc/ssh/sshd_config" tiedostosta, että "PubkeyAuthentication yes" rivin alussa ei ole "#"-merkkiä.
  • Nimeä authorized_keys tiedosto uudelleen. mv /usr/NX/home/nx/.ssh/authorized_keys2 /usr/NX/home/nx/.ssh/authorized_keys
  • Varmista, että konenimi on /etc/hosts tiedostossa

Pikapainikkeet

Alkuperäiseen työpöytään "koko näyttö"-tilasta pääsee painamalla hiirellä oikeassa yläkulmassa.

NX 3.x version pikapainikkeet

Näppäinyhdistelmä Selitys
Ctrl+Alt+Shift+Esc Päästäksesi eroon jumiutuneesta sessiosta
Ctrl + Alt + T Lopettaaksesi käynnissä olevan session
Ctrl + Alt + F Vaihtaaksesi "koko näyttö" tilan ja "ikkunoidun" tilan välillä.(*)
Ctrl + Alt + M Pienentääksesi tai suurentaaksesi "koko näyttö".
Ctrl + Alt + nuolipainike näyttöalueen navigointia.
Ctrl + Alt + numeronäppäinten nuolipainike näyttöalueen navigointia.
Ctrl + Alt + R Vaihtaaksesi "automaattisen koko muutoksen" ja "näyttöalueen" välillä. (*)
Ctrl + Alt + E Vaihtaaksesi päälle ja pois näytön viivästetty päivittäminen.
Ctrl + Alt + J Pakottaaksesi synkronointi jos näytön visuaalisuudessa on ongelmia.
Alt + F4 NX ikkunan ollessa aktiivinen voit valita keskeytystilan tai lopettamisen.
Ctrl + Alt + K Päälle/Pois Alt + Tab ja Print Screen painikkeet.

(*) Tulee Windows clientiin NX versiossa 4.0.0
Englannin kieliset selitykset löytyvät NX:n sivuilta.

Haettu osoitteesta http://opensuse.fi/Nxserver